What is Imago Therapy?

The main tool of Imago Relationship Therapy is a dialogue technique which is prescriptive  at first, but gradually becomes relaxed and playful as time goes on and the steps become ingrained. The various dialogues provide a way of learning more about yourself and your partner, as well as the problems that keep you apart, so that you can better understand your relationship and begin to work together to improve it in a way that serves you both.

Above all, Imago Relationship Therapy is a SAFE way to explore and understand your relationship – and not just your romantic relationship, as the theory applies to all of your close relationships.  It can also help you to hold a mirror up to your own self in order to better understand who YOU are and how your past experiences have either held you back or pushed you forwards.

Imago can also be a useful technique between friends, colleagues, teachers and students, and anyone else in close relationship. It is used as far afield as Palestine and I have used the technique myself in a Togolese prison to help resolve conflict and promote understanding between different groups.  Nowadays, its use in helping to resolve political and religious conflicts is becoming more and more important.
